Job Description

  • EYFS Teacher

  • BS34

  • Part-Time or Full-Time Opportunity

  • September Start

A friendly Primary School with a strong community feel in the South Gloucestershire area is looking for a full-time or part-time teacher to work in their Early Years class from September.

The school really encourages their children to build curiosity in their learning, through a supportive team around them. This is a 1 form entry school, where you will be working alongside a teaching assistant who will provide additional support for children with special educational needs.

The Role

This role is a long-term position to start from September covering Maternity leave.

The Head Teacher is looking for a candidate with experience in KS1 or EYFS who has great phonics knowledge and has high expectations of learning outcomes. You’ll be working with a motivated, fun staff team who are passionate about developing their practice and the provision for our children and families.

You will be expected to:

  • Plan and deliver fun and exciting activities and lessons.

  • Provide learning opportunities inside and outside the classroom.

  • Work alongside your partner teacher and communicate clearly about children’s development.

  • Follow the schools behaviour and safeguarding policy.

  • Have engaging Positive Behaviour Management techniques.
